Trauma has taken root in Thea’s soul, leaving behind questions she can no longer silence. When long-buried memories begin to surface, the truth presses in demanding to be seen, felt, and faced.
Adopted by the Mirascan people, Thea has always believed herself to be human. But as fragments of her past return, doubt follows. Drawn by questions she can’t answer and a pull she can’t explain, she steps beyond the only world she has ever known, hoping to uncover who she truly is.
Her search leads her into the unknown and into the path of Ilan. Through him, Thea begins to unravel the lies that shaped her life, awakening a deep ache of anger, betrayal, and grief. What she uncovers changes everything.
Caught in the center of a living prophecy, Thea learns of Creashu, the world of her origin, and the calling placed upon her life. As new gifts awaken within her, she must decide whether she will allow her pain to define her---or refine her.
Determined to pursue truth, forgiveness, and the path set before her, Thea faces a choice that will alter more than her own destiny. The future of two worlds hangs in the balance, and the role she was born to fulfill can no longer be ignored. But becoming a Prophecy Changer was never meant to be easy.

I started writing for adults, especially moms in ministry, but it didn’t take long to realize there weren’t many fiction options parents felt good about for their teens—so I shaped Prophecy Changer to be a clean, meaningful story that not only adults would enjoy, but that young adults could connect with too.
It’s an adventurous, hope-filled story that entertains while gently encouraging reflection, courage, and faith.
It addresses identity, fear, forgiveness, and calling on a heart level—without explicit content or harmful themes. It will hit the heart in a good way.
I believe readers will walk away encouraged, strengthened, and a heart posture with expectation for great things within their own lives---and---hopefully excited about book two!
Through allegory or (extended metaphor), the story models surrender, trust, truth, and spiritual authority—opening doors for natural faith conversations.
Fantasy bypasses defenses and engages the heart, allowing truth to be discovered rather than preached.
Yes. It is clean, age-appropriate, and suitable for adults, teens, homeschool families, and shared reading.
This story prioritizes meaning over magic and the whole idea of magic is questioned. In Prophecy Changer, there is no “good” or “bad” magic, only magic (the counterfeit) vs the power of God through Holy Spirit. It’s grounded, purposeful, and emotionally resonant—I think one who doesn’t enjoy fantasy can see this “fantasy” as a vehicle, not the focus.
